At Hart Energy's recent DUG Bakken conference, Gibson Scott, a director at ITG Investment Research, discussed how the firm has seen certain completions methods work better in core rock, rather than noncore, in the Williston Basin, Eagle Ford, Permian Basin and D-J Basin. Proppant-intensive wells, and the types of fluids used, stand out above coiled tubing-conveyed fracks and other methods including plug and perf or sliding sleeve, as step changes in completions, he said.
